GM sells vehicles on six continents and in 192 countries, owns facilities in 53 countries across more than 23 time zones and employs a global workforce of 266,000 from around the world who speaks more than fifty languages. Diversity is an integral aspect of every facet of our business. Diversity is our customers, our employees, our suppliers, our dealers and our communities worldwide.
GM Past: GM has a history of commitment to diversity is known for its leadership—and in fact has a number of “firsts” relative to Diversity. GM was the first automaker with a Minority Dealer Initiative, the first automaker with a Minority Supplier Initiative and the first to offer a Women’s Retail Initiative. GM’s Diversity Initiatives continue to evolve and is driven by a comprehensive strategy. GM has received many diversity-related awards for their work and accomplishments. In 2000 GM added to its Core Values: Individual Respect and Responsibility recognizing business success worldwide begins with each and every employee and leader taking responsibility for respecting others.
